General Information

Title: Aspice Domine
Composer: Ippolito Baccusi
Lyricist:

Number of voices: 6vv   Voicings: SSAATB, SSATTB and AATTBB
Genre: SacredMotet

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ella

First published: 1579
    2nd published: 1583 in Harmoniae miscellae cantionum sacrarum, no. 39
